Tesco shoppers excited over new strawberry Jammie Dodgers flavour

Tesco customers are thrilled about the launch of Jammie Dodgers Really Fruity Strawberry Flavour Biscuits, with social media brimming with positive responses and overwhelming demand leading to online sell-outs.

Tesco Shoppers Excited Over New Strawberry Jammie Dodgers Flavour

Tesco customers have expressed great enthusiasm for the latest addition to the Jammie Dodgers range, unveiled on store shelves recently. The new variation, called Jammie Dodgers Really Fruity Strawberry Flavour Biscuits, has captivated the attention of biscuit enthusiasts, with many eager to try the novel twist on this beloved treat.

The new product was highlighted on the Newfoodsuk Facebook group, where it garnered immediate and positive reactions from fans. The social media post announced, “New Strawberry Jammie Dodgers now available at Tesco!!” and described the product as consisting of a strawberry-flavoured apple jam sandwiched between two strawberry-flavoured shortcake biscuits.

The announcement quickly spread across social media, attracting numerous comments from excited shoppers. Responses included comments such as “Yummy,” “These are banging,” and “These are so good,” with one enthusiastic fan confirming, “Can confirm very nice.”

Tesco is currently offering the Jammie Dodgers Really Fruity Strawberry Flavour Biscuits at a promotional Clubcard price of 65p, valid until September 10. However, the overwhelming demand has led to the product being sold out online, reflecting its instant popularity.

This new flavour follows a previous introduction of banana-flavoured Jammie Dodgers, which were released in Home Bargain stores in May 2022. These biscuits were inspired by the Minions film “The Rise of Gru,” and similarly created quite a stir among Jammie Dodgers aficionados.

As the Jammie Dodgers Really Fruity Strawberry Flavour Biscuits continue to entice and satisfy curious tastebuds, fans are keenly looking out for their availability, both in physical stores and online.
